School District #91 Bond Fails

IDAHO FALLS - A strong voter turnout for Idaho Falls School District #91 didn't help the $84.5 million bond pass.

Long lines formed at some precincts just before the voting closed.  In the end 3,357 or 56.33 percent voted in favor of the bond, while 2,603 or 43.67 percent voted no.  The district needed a super majority vote to pass the bond.

If the bond would have passed, the district would have used the money to rebuild four schools, and build an entirely new school.
